East London businesses GetSet to Conquer Supply Chains

Business growth experts GetSet for Growth are launching a new initiative, up-skilling and preparing East London SMEs to access the supply chain opportunities they need to scale up their businesses.


The Procurement Toolbox is a brand new workshop series complete with tender support resources launching on Tuesday 6th September.


The series will shine a light on the requirements and best practices of accessing supply chains, giving ambitious SMEs the tools and skills they need to become more competitive and fit to supply.


Over the course of this unique series, businesses will have the chance to attend seminars presented by industry experts, corporate buyers and SMEs who have been successful in selling to large companies.


All essential topics for procurement success in different types of supply chains will be covered, as well as learning from sector specialists, such as construction and cyber security.


Businesses will begin expanding their skills at the launch event with the help of some of GetSet’s knowledgeable partners, including speakers from professional service giant KPMG, UK driver of inclusive procurement MSDUK, and strategic outsourcing and energy services company Mitie.


Attendees will learn from talks by like-minded businesses as they share their own pitfalls and success stories, tried and true methods and insider glimpses into the opportunities of large buyers and procurers.

“We want to give business owners the opportunity to interact, speak to and learn from their peers as well as large companies so they can confidently and compliantly complete an open tender or present their services or products to a buyer in a large organisation,” says Gregg Harding, GetSet for Growth East London Project Director.
“We recognise the importance of the traditional ‘Meet the Buyer’ approach and how many large buyers, through these and similar processes, allow SMEs access to their supply chains. In addition to giving businesses direct links to real, live opportunities, the Procurement Toolbox will also sign-post SMEs across East London to tenders, useful sources of information and tender resources, and provide hands on support to increase their ability to compete for, win and execute supply chain opportunities.”

GetSet for Growth currently operates across most of the UK, funded by J.P. Morgan and the Regional Growth Fund.


Since its launch in 2013, over 3,500 SMEs have benefitted from GetSet’s specialist growth service.


Ranging from small newer businesses to well-established £20 million turnover companies, and across all sectors, the GetSet community has a collective value of nearly £1 billion.


GetSet has a 98% success rate in helping those businesses who seek finance to achieve it, and already over 500 new jobs have been created as a result of their growth support.
